POSITION SUMMARY:
The Indirect Procurement Department is accountable for the supply management activities across all categories of Bass Pro indirect spend (e.g., Logistics, Marketing, IT, Facilities, etc.). To maximize the efficiency of its work, the Procurement Department has selected a suite of software tools that support the company’s supply management activities. The Operational Analysts assist with the system and contract administration required to support the organization
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
- Assists with preparing, routing and tracking contract documents, assists in uploading completed contracts and the corresponding metadata into the contract administration module, and produces reports on contract status for the entire organization
- Supports the maintenance of data feeds to the spend analytics module that tracks and classifies all indirect spend, and provides the first level of analysis on data accuracy and completeness
- Helps ensure that the Procure-to-Pay (P2P) module is up to date including uploading vendor catalogs and item content as well as making sure that new suppliers and internal users are enabled to transact in the tool
- Assists with placing purchase orders for capital goods and/or services in support of organizational requirements
- May execute “spot buys” as needed to secure non-standard goods and services not included in the core assortment

What We Do
Bass Pro Shops is North America’s premier outdoor and conservation company. Founded in 1972 when Johnny Morris began selling tackle out of his father’s liquor store in Springfield, Missouri, today we provide customers with premier destination retail in more than 150 locations across North America. In 2017 Bass Pro Shops acquired Cabela’s to create a “best-of-the-best” experience with superior products, dynamic locations and outstanding customer service. Guided by the visionary leadership of our founder and CEO Johnny Morris, Bass Pro Shops is making a significant impact in on the future of conservation and the communities we serve. More than 40 years after Johnny began helping people connect with nature through a tiny bait shop, our conservation mission is to inspire people to enjoy, love and conserve the great outdoors. Beyond retail, Bass Pro Shops also operates White River Marine Group, the world’s largest manufacturer of boats, plus award-winning resorts and nature destinations including Big Cedar Lodge, America’s Premier Wilderness Resort.
